Notice
Recent Posts
Recent Comments
Link
250x250
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| |
7 | 8 | 9 | 10 | 11 | 12 | 13 |
14 | 15 | 16 | 17 | 18 | 19 | 20 |
21 | 22 | 23 | 24 | 25 | 26 | 27 |
28 | 29 | 30 |
Tags
- 구글캘린더api
- 리액트세팅
- 전자정부 서버세팅
- spring
- js
- 자바
- 리액트초기세팅
- 웹앱
- 기초코딩
- 자바스크립트기초
- 마이바티스
- springboot
- Spring Boot
- javaspring
- 자바스크립트 기초
- java
- 웹
- 자바스크립트기초문법
- 스프링부트
- react
- 자바스크립트
- 코딩
- 구글 oauth
- 리액트프로젝트세팅
- 기초 코딩
- CSS
- mybatis
- Javascript
- HTML
- 처음만나는자바스크립트
Archives
- Today
- Total
인생 디벨로퍼
개인정보 detail 필수값 뿌리기 (select) 본문
728x90
개인정보 필수값은 개인정보 detail 페이지를 포함한 모든 resume 페이지에 동일하게 적용되는 부분이다.
Controller
empInfo 를 키값으로 model에 담기.
세션에 저장된 emlpoyeeId 값으로 조회해아 하기 때문에,
principal.getId() 로 조회 한다.
Repository
.xml
view
<div class="my_name">
<h3>${empInfo.employeeFullname}</h3>
</div>
<div class="d-flex">
<div>
<div>
<span class="my_info_title">아이디</span>
<span class="my_info">${empInfo.employeeName}</span>
</div>
<div>
<span class="my_info_title">생년월일</span>
<span class="my_info">${empInfo.employeeBirth}</span>
</div>
<div>
<span class="my_info_title">연락처</span>
<span class="my_info">${empInfo.employeeTel}</span>
</div>
</div>
<div class="my_info_title_margin">
<div>
<span class="my_info_title">주소</span>
<span class="my_info">${empInfo.employeeAddress}</span>
</div>
<div>
<span class="my_info_title">이메일</span>
<span class="my_info">${empInfo.employeeEmail}</span>
</div>
</div>
</div>
</div>
<div class="my_info_thumbnail">
<img src="${empInfo.employeeThumbnail == null ? '/images/kakao.jpg' : empInfo.employeeThumbnail}"
alt="Current Photo" class="img-fluid" id="imagePreview" />
</div>
</div>
</div>
</div>
model에 담은 키값 empInfo 로, 모든 값을 뿌려준다.
728x90
'Project > Mini Project - Rodonin (구인구직)' 카테고리의 다른 글
이력서 리스트 만들기 쿼리 / 절대 간단하지 않은 join (0) | 2023.03.07 |
---|---|
개인정보 뿌리기 (select, inner join) / 가장 간단한 inner join (0) | 2023.03.06 |
개인정보 insert (form) (0) | 2023.03.06 |
Ajax를 이용한 update (개인정보 수정) (0) | 2023.02.27 |
date 타입 날짜 받기 (0) | 2023.02.27 |